Audrey E. Hendricks, Associate Professor of Statistics in the Department of Mathematical and Statistical Sciences, along with 10 student authors published, “Summix: A method for detecting and adjusting for population structure in genetic summary data,” this month in the American Journal of Human Genetics.  Many of these students received funding through the EUReCA! program. Summix is an important method to increase the utility and equity of large genetic databases for people of all ancestries. Many of the undergraduate students on this project started on the research when they were undergraduates are now in or will be in graduate programs.
